Troy announced 27 signees, with another one, defensive end Antonio Harper, sending in his paperwork late today.

Harper signed with Miami out of high school, but went to Hargrave Military School. He was going to re-up with Miami, but didn’t have his grades there. It’s a situation similar to Brandon Lang, who first signed with Georgia.

The kid’s got a few stars by his name, which makes fans happy.

On a few more signees

CB Bradley Wallace - “I had him rated as the top high school guy we were recruiting at that position.“

CB Mike Robinson - “He’s a big, big corner that can run a very low 100-meter electric time.“

CB Sergio Perez - “I was really impressed with him as a young man.“

CB Barry Valcin - “He’s a community college corner that’s an impressive looking young man that our coaches know a lot more than I do about him.“

I’d have to go back and look what all Troy lost, if anything. DT Montavious Williams signed with South Alabama, but Troy coaches weren’t expecting him to qualify academically.
